Output 66e86940eec0bfdc5520ad76f164d218014e442d97abe35e1c2e9438c1565b36:1

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e10cbf9aefccb128d2f0d4a63a15cd7622eada16a199d8d96fde4d940b3e15ca
address
tb1puyxtlxh0ejcj35hs6jnr59wdwc3w4ksk5xva3kt0mexegze7zh9qqs0fu7
transaction
66e86940eec0bfdc5520ad76f164d218014e442d97abe35e1c2e9438c1565b36
confirmations
66132
spent
true